About the role

  • Group Environmental Compliance Manager at Babcock leading environmental assurance across a global organisation. Strengthening best practices in compliance, audits, and environmental management.

Responsibilities

  • Strengthening environmental assurance across a global organisation
  • Lead environmental assurance assessments, audits, and compliance checks across UK and international sites
  • Support and enhance the Group’s approach to environmental protection
  • Provide expert environmental management guidance across the organisation
  • Develop and deliver initiatives that drive compliance and continuous improvement
  • Analyse complex environmental data and prepare insightful reporting for stakeholders

Requirements

  • Extensive professional experience in environmental management and environmental legislation
  • Knowledge of international regulatory requirements
  • Experience developing, maintaining, and auditing ISO 14001 Environmental Management Systems
  • Leading site and portfolio level environmental compliance reviews
  • Managing key environmental controls and procedures (waste management, pollution prevention, spill response, etc.)
  • Strong ability to manage, interrogate, and analyse complex data sets
  • Excellent communication skills and experience preparing high‑quality written reports
  • Degree in Environmental Management or a related discipline
  • Membership of ISEP or an equivalent professional body
  • Recognised internal auditor qualification
  • Advanced Environmental Management certification (e.g., NEBOSH Diploma in Environmental Management)
